乙烯四聚高选择性合成1-辛烯
具有"原子经济性"反应的高选择性和低能耗性
符合绿色化工的发展趋势
备受学术界及工业界的青睐。本文综述了近年来乙烯四聚合成1-辛烯研究的最新进展
涉及乙烯四聚催化体系中的配体和助催化剂以及反应体系的溶剂等方面
讨论了乙烯四聚合成1-辛烯的反应机理
并展望了该技术的工业应用前景。
With the development of green chemical engineering
1-octene prepared vis ethylene tetramerization is Atomic economy’ reaction. It has an advantage of high selectivity and low energy consumption
which have attracted considerable attention in the academic and industrial field. In this paper
the latest progress of ethylene tetramerization to 1-octene has been summarized from ligand
cocatalyst
solvent and the reaction mechanisms.
